WebWith growing interest in organic crop production, there is also a need to develop crops that will perform well in organic systems. Such varieties should be disease and pest resistant, high yielding with low inputs, and high in nutritional value and flavor. Book excerpt: There is an increasing need for an understanding of the fundamental processes involved in the … WebThe Cornell tomato breeding/genetics program has taken a multiple disease approach to reducing the need for fungicide sprays. Because there are several foliar diseases impacting tomato production, having a hybrid with resistance to one disease will reduce the need for fungicides with targeted activity for it, but not the need to apply broad ...
